I know we have lots of 3rd party support on the action figure end, but G.I. Joe is seriously lacking any third party support on the vehicle end. I'm also a fan of transformers and I see company after company making their version of Devastator or any number of other popular characters and it got me thinking.
Here on the Tank we have all the creative minds and resources necessary to design, R&D, and with a Kickstarter surely fund production of G.I. Joe scale military vehicles that while not copying directly could certainly capture all the elements of new versions of the vehicles we all love. I know there have to be others of us on the creative end that have thought "if only I could do (X) part of this process I could make a production line of new toys." We just need to assemble an interested team with the skills and knowledge to move forward. I know that if we put together our collective skills and experience on this board we could make it a reality. Although making a plan and sticking to it for a bunch of creative types while still holding down our day jobs and families and such could be like herding cats. "A journey of a thousand miles begins with a single step." So in short I'm gonna throw it out there, flame me, make fun of me, tell me it's too difficult, I just want to see what kind of response this gets. Unfortunately, I don't have the skills to take part in such an endeavor. But, I have thought about this idea before, & I have ideas and a willingness to get behind a Kickstarter campaign; should someone decide to take on this idea.
Based on the quality of their product & customer service, I would love to see Marauder inc. roll with this. I've dealt with them before, as a customer, and I trust their decision making processes in keeping this idea highly detailed, interchangeable & affordable. I would love to see 3 chassis/ frames: 1. 4x4 (humvee type) 2. 6x6 (light armored vehicle type) 3. Tank (full treads) Tires could be interchangeable or not (not a deal breaker) Vehicle bodies could be interchangeable & snap onto the frames, like the top canopy of the APC attaches to the body of the vehicle. Of course, vehicle bodies and attachable accessories could be cast in multiple colors; black, white, green, tan & Cobra blue. I would use battle kata roadblock as my figure to test the functionality of the vehicles. If battle kata roadblock can fit in the vehicle, comfortably; then the scale should work for most characters. |

As a possible alternative to offering complete vehicles, a possible "jumpstarter"/kickstarter would be add on options for existing Joe vehicles. Sort of a way to test the waters.
Some possible options could be: 1) Fully armored canopy/doors for the VAMP/Ninja Combat Cruiser and a half-track conversion kit - just ideas. The possibilities here are endless. 2) Alternative pintle-mounted weapons for the same vehicle. 3) An add-on "horse-shoue" housing for the Retaliation HiSS to turn it into a troop carrier like this: http://1.bp.blogspot.com/-FNknAvuZyN...cept_art_1.jpg It would clamp-on each side using the weapon mounting holes on the side of the sides and the turret ring on top. It could use a missile launcher off of the NCC to keep it simple. (I have been thinking about this one for a long time) 4) Conversion kits for some of the Marvel's Avengers vehicles to transform them into Joe/Cobra vehicles. 5) Conversion kit to turn the RHINO into a dedicated troop carrier. 6) A ski conversion kit for the Ice Cutter - eliminating those silly flopping treads. 7) Other canopy options for the Tread Ripper. 8) Eagle Hawk conversion kit to make it a Cobra vehicle. These projects could start small and get progressively more ambitious. |
